EXPERIENCE LOUISIANA FESTIVAL
OCTOBER 18, 2015
The weather was perfect for the start of the all new Experience Louisiana festival on the campus of LSU Eunice Saturday and again Sunday. The event was sponsored by the Eunice Rotary Club as a fund raiser for LSU Eunice whose state funding has been drastically reduced. The crowds of people gathered on the huge campus and enjoyed the foods, live music and dozens of booths of crafts men.

There was live Cajun and Zydeco music on the main bandstand and a large dance stage. Crafts men were showing demonstrations on black smithing and many other crafts. There was a large classic car show organized by John R., Young.
From all indications, it was a huge success.
